WebThe first law of thermodynamics states that the change in internal energy of a closed system equals the net heat transfer into the system minus the net work done by the system. In equation form, the first law of thermodynamics is. Δ U = Q − W. 12.6. Here, Δ U is the change in internal energy, U, of the system. Web5 okt. 2024 · Zero work is done when the displacement of a body is zero or perpendicular (θ=900,cosθ=0) to the direction of force applied, then work done is zero. For example, if a person tries to push a wall, he is applying force yet the wall does not move, so the displacement of the wall is zero, and hence work done is zero. Web3 aug. 2024 · When work done by an external force on a mass reduces the energy of that mass then we say that the work done is negative. The energy here does not disappear, but is, instead, lost to the surroundings in the form of heat or thermal energy. Friction does negative work – How? When an object moves the frictional force opposes the motion.
